1. Reputation

The reputation of your window installer is important since it will have an impact on how quickly you can get your new double-glazed windows put in and the quality of the work. The online reputation of the company will give you an idea of the kind of service you can expect from them, however, it's recommended to speak with other homeowners in your local area who have had the pleasure of working with a certain double glazing installation company.

Reputable double glazed window installers will be able to meet the highest standards when it comes to their work and satisfaction of customers. Ideally, they should be members of the Glass and Glazing Federation (GGF), Double Glazing and Conservatory Ombudsman Scheme (DGCOS) or the Fenestration Self-Assessment Scheme (FENSA).


Rebecca Orde, a residential project manager, suggests homeowners get quotes from a variety of FENSA registered double glazed window installers prior to making a final decision. This will help you understand what goes into the quote and make sure that the quote is for the correct dimensions of windows, fittings and materials.

You should tell the installers what you'd like and the number of windows you are replacing. Also, let them know the style you prefer. Include a breakdown of both the cost of the window and the labor cost.

It is also helpful to specify the type of frame you're looking for as some window frames aren't suitable for double glazing. For instance, if have uPVC windows with a low rebate, you'll need to apply a retrofitting process to make a double-glazed window.

3. Insurance

Double glazing has many benefits, including sound and thermal insulation. By installing two panes of glass with an insulating gap that is filled with inert gas like krypton or argon to reduce heat transfer and reduce your energy costs. Furthermore, double-glazed windows can cut outside noise and make your home more cozy.

Find a business that has a broad range of options, and is accredited by FENSA. FENSA-registered companies must meet stringent requirements and adhere to the latest building regulations, which provides additional peace of mind for homeowners.

A reputable installer should also offer a comprehensive guarantee and warranty on their products. It could be a full or a portion of the cost for replacement and even labour costs according to the warranty terms.

You should also inquire with your friends, family members, and neighbours about their experiences with double-glazing window companies. Personal recommendations are more useful than online reviews as they provide first-hand details on the quality of service. For example, they can determine if a specific company showed up on time, completed the job within budget and then cleaned up afterward.

Insurance is essential for double-glazing installers because their work requires the highest level of precision and carries a significant risk. Accidental damage is common during installation and transport that can result in costly repairs. A minor error could result in a client being injured. A double-glazing contractor who is not insured would be responsible for all expenses.

Public liability insurance is a must for any double-glazing company that is reputable to protect them and their customers from costly damage and injuries. This type of insurance covers personal injury as well as property damage and public liability. It also covers the cost of replacing equipment and tools in case they are lost or stolen. Additionally, it could aid a double-glazing business in attracting new business and build trust with their customers by demonstrating that they care about safety. It also helps them avoid legal penalties in the event that they are found to be responsible for an injury or accident.

4. Warranty

A warranty is an important part of installing double-glazed windows. It will shield you from costly repairs or replacement if the windows are not functioning properly. You can also feel more secure in your investment. The type of warranty you get will depend on the company you choose to install your new windows. Some companies offer a lifetime guarantee, whereas others offer a limited lifetime warranty. The warranty should clearly specify the period for which the window is covered and what defects are covered.
